How It Works

Check Electricity Bill Online in 4 Simple Steps

The PITC duplicate bill system works the same for every DISCO. Here is exactly what happens when you enter your reference number.

01

Find Your Reference Number

Your 10–14 digit reference number is printed at the top-left of every paper bill from MEPCO, LESCO, FESCO, or any DISCO. It also appears in your DISCO's SMS billing alerts.

02

Enter It in the Bill Checker

Paste or type the reference number into the search form on our homepage. Select your DISCO if prompted — most reference formats auto-detect the company.

03

Your Official Bill Loads Instantly

We forward your reference to the official PITC bill presentation system. Your authentic duplicate bill — with every line item, tariff, and tax — renders directly from the government portal.

04

Save or Print as Needed

Use your browser's print function (Ctrl+P → Save as PDF) to get a digital copy for banking requirements, rental agreements, or dispute documentation.

Where is my reference number?

On the top section of your electricity bill, often labeled Reference No. or Consumer Reference. It is 10–14 digits.

Is the duplicate bill official?

The data comes from the same PITC portal your DISCO uses. We display it without editing line items.

What is FPA on my bill?

Fuel Price Adjustment reflects changes in generation fuel costs. It can raise or lower your bill even when usage is similar month to month.
